What's Included in a Water Damage Remediation Job in Mesa?

Water Damage Remediation is the complete process of identifying moisture sources, extracting standing water, drying structural cavities, and sanitizing affected building materials. Water Damage Remediation includes industrial-grade water extraction, removal of ruined porous materials like wet insulation and drywall, and the setup of heavy-duty air movers and dehumidifiers to pull trapped moisture from studs and subfloors. Classic Restoration focuses on rapid response and precise moisture mapping for Water Damage Remediation. Thermal imaging cameras and digital moisture meters are used to locate hidden water behind baseboards and inside wall cavities, making sure no damp pockets are left behind to cause secondary damage. By monitoring daily evaporation rates, Classic Restoration tracks structural drying progress until materials return to standard dry indoor humidity levels.

In Mesa, water damage often stems from broken supply lines, faulty water heaters, or monsoon roof leaks interacting with desert-dried building materials. Local homes constructed with stucco and wood framing require immediate action because trapped moisture creates an ideal breeding ground for mold within 48 hours. Homeowners in Mesa frequently worry about structural integrity and whether belongings can be saved during Water Damage Remediation. Personal property is salvaged whenever possible through specialized cleaning and rapid drying techniques, while items contaminated by category 3 black water are safely discarded. Every step of Water Damage Remediation is documented with moisture logs to support homeowner insurance claims.

Classic Restoration completes the project by applying EPA-registered antimicrobial treatments to prevent mold colonization and preparing the space for any necessary rebuild work. Why Immediate Water Damage Remediation Prevents Major Structural Failures in Mesa Homes

Mesa, AZ has a very dry climate, which actually creates unique challenges when indoor flooding occurs in a home because dry building materials absorb moisture very rapidly. When a pipe bursts or an appliance leaks inside a local home in Mesa, drywall and baseboards act like sponges, pulling water upward through capillary action. Classic Restoration works with homeowners in Mesa, AZ to handle insurance claims for Water Damage Remediation. Most standard homeowner insurance policies cover sudden and accidental water damage like burst pipes or appliance supply line failures. Classic Restoration documents all moisture readings, takes detailed photographs, and provides thorough drying logs directly to your insurance adjuster. This documentation supports your claim and helps streamline approval for remediation and repair costs. Flood damage from external rising water typically requires separate flood insurance coverage.
When Classic Restoration performs Water Damage Remediation for properties in Mesa, AZ, structural drying typically takes between 3 to 5 days depending on the extent of saturation and the building materials involved. Water Damage Remediation requires specialized equipment, so our team uses high-velocity air movers and professional dehumidifiers to accelerate evaporation rates safely. Technicians visit daily to measure moisture content levels until structural components reach standard dry guidelines. Once readings normalize, the equipment is removed and the area is ready for final repairs in Mesa, AZ.
Drywall and flooring can often be saved if remediation begins within the first 24 hours before saturation causes permanent breakdown. Porous materials sitting in standing water for extended periods must be cut out and removed to prevent mold and rot. Hardwood floors can frequently be saved using specialized injectidry extraction systems that pull trapped moisture from beneath the planks without destruction.
